A fibre optic adapter, sometimes also called a coupler, is a small device designed to terminate or link the fibre optic cables or fibre optic connectors between two fibre optic lines. The distance that a signal can be transmitted over a multimode fiber cable depends on the type of cable and the data rate of the signal. The "OM" (Optical Mode) classification system is used to differentiate between different types of multimode fibers based on their capabilities.
